Go语言开发:Linux环境搭建与数据库配置速成指南

在Linux环境下搭建Go语言开发环境,首先需要安装Go语言编译器。可以通过官方包管理器或者从官网下载二进制文件进行安装。对于Ubuntu系统,可以使用apt-get命令安装,例如:sudo apt-get install golang。

安装完成后,建议配置环境变量,确保Go命令可以在终端中直接调用。编辑~/.bashrc或~/.zshrc文件,添加GOBIN路径,并执行source命令使配置生效。

AI生成图像,仅供参考

Go语言支持多种数据库操作,常见的有MySQL、PostgreSQL等。以MySQL为例,需要先安装MySQL服务器和客户端。在Ubuntu上可以使用sudo apt-get install mysql-server来完成安装。

安装完数据库后,需要创建数据库和用户,并授权访问权限。通过mysql -u root -p登录数据库,执行CREATE DATABASE和GRANT语句进行配置。

在Go项目中连接数据库,可以使用标准库database/sql结合相应的驱动。例如,使用go-sql-driver/mysql驱动,通过go get命令安装,然后在代码中使用sql.Open函数建立连接。

数据库连接成功后,可以执行查询、插入、更新等操作。注意处理错误和关闭连接,避免资源泄漏。使用defer db.Close()确保程序结束时释放数据库资源。

为了提高开发效率,建议使用IDE如VS Code或GoLand,并安装Go插件。这些工具提供代码高亮、自动补全和调试功能,有助于快速编写和测试代码。

dawei

【声明】:舟山站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复